Today I’m sharing my favorite tried and true makeup products. Together you get this natural glowy look that feels effortless and fresh!

Step 1: Start with a freshly cleansed face and apply your favorite vitamin C serum and moisturizer.

Step 2: Apply Glow Screen, I just do this with my hands. I have stepped away from using a foundation and have been going super natural lately. I love this formula because it offers a little coverage and it has SPF 45 and gives your skin a beautiful glow.

Step 3: With my BeautyBlender I apply some concealer under my eyes to brighten and hide the dark circles from the lack of sleep I’ve been getting lately. My hands-down favorite concealer is the Giorgio Armani formula.

Step 4: I add a little bronzer to contour. I use Too Faced Chocolate Mousse (sold out, similar here).

Step 5: I apply a little sparkle eyeshadow from Urban Decay all over my lid then add a little more bronzer to the corners.

Step 6: I fill my brows in with this pencil

Step 7: Mascara, the Chanel formula is my favorite!!! I’ve been using it for 2 years and nothing compares. It lifts, lengthens and doesn’t clump!!

Step 8: Lips and done!! This combo is my current go-to... Liner: Pillow Talk, Lipstick: Creme D'Nude, Gloss: BeautyBio Lip Serum
